Free Prompt Hacks to Keep AI Faces Consistent

These five prompt tactics give fast consistency gains without any paid tools.

  1. Seed Lock Method: Use the same seed number (–seed 12345) across generations to keep a stable facial structure.
  2. Negative Prompt Stacking: Add phrases like “deformed face, asymmetrical eyes, different person” to block unwanted variations.
  3. Attention Weighting: Highlight key traits with syntax such as (blue eyes:1.3) or (heart-shaped face:1.2).
  4. Reference Image Prompting: Upload consistent headshots and pair them with “in the style of [character name]” for tools like Midjourney.
  5. Lighting Consistency: Repeat the same lighting phrase, such as “soft studio lighting, even skin tone,” in every prompt.

These hacks support daily Instagram posts and OnlyFans content packs while keeping a recognizable character identity. They still demand constant prompt tracking and occasionally create inconsistencies that need manual edits.

Seven Common Mistakes That Break AI Influencer Consistency

These seven mistakes frequently destroy AI influencer consistency and waste creator time.

  1. One-off Prompts: Writing different descriptions for the same character across sessions.
  2. Ignoring Lighting Continuity: Mixing studio, natural, and dramatic lighting without a clear pattern.
  3. Dataset Contamination: Training with shuffled data that teaches order instead of visual features.
  4. Gradient Accumulation Errors: Skipping optimizer resets, which can cause unstable model behavior.
  5. Insufficient Reference Images: Relying on blurry or inconsistent source photos for character definition.
  6. Platform Switching: Jumping between AI generators without learning each tool’s consistency rules.
  7. Batch Generation Neglect: Creating images one by one instead of generating coordinated sets for campaigns.

How to keep face consistent in AI generated images

Face consistency depends on reference quality, generation method, and prompt structure. Use high-resolution, well-lit reference photos that show multiple angles. Apply seed locking, negative prompts, and attention weighting to stabilize facial structure. Many advanced creators move to reference-guided generation or instant likeness tools that remove most manual prompt work.
